The north-east energy industry manufacturer and service provider has been nominated in the small exporter of the year category. Organised by Business Quarter in conjunction with Scottish Enterprise, the awards celebrate the export achievement of businesses right across Scotland.

Established in 2001, Flowline Specialists designs, engineers and manufactures a range of equipment that safely handles flexible pipes, umbilicals and cables for the global oil and gas, subsea and renewable industries.

The firm has worked steadily over the past five years to grow and diversify its business, with the contribution made by exports increasing significantly. Turnover for the year to end 31 March 2011 was £1.37million, and this grew to £6.3million by the year ending 31 March 2015. During the same period, the contribution made by exports had risen from 15% to 50%.

To aid this export growth Flowline Specialists established a number of operational bases overseas. Alongside its Oldmeldrum headquarters and a manufacturing facility in Fyvie, the firm has overseas bases in Norway, Holland, Singapore and Dubai. These overseas bases allow the firm to better serve its international markets.

As Decom North Sea members understand, offshore decommissioning is a developing £multibillion market with legislation driven demand even in the current O&G market downturn. Whilst field life extension is a strategic goal, it is an inescapable reality that oil and gas wells will continue to be plugged & abandoned for many years, not just in the UKCS but elsewhere around the globe.

Our initial focus is the well P&A market and PLASMABIT will bring significant cost and time savings. Applications are focused on section milling and slot recovery and subscale field prototypes and all components of the core

technology PLASMABIT have been successfully demonstrated. This work has been undertaken at our state of the art Technology Centre with 2,580 sq. meters of laboratory space, with EUR 11.2 million of equipment and advanced testing facilities. The Initial full product for oil & gas well abandonment is expected to be brought to market in 2018.

But just what is PLASMABIT and how does it work?Plasma is an ionized 3 000 – 6 000 °C hot gas and we create a very focussed and controlled electric arc to produce a continuous plasma discharge. This heat is contained within the PLASMABIT tool and allows contactless drilling and milling in high pressure, high temperature downhole conditions.

The plasma we create can disintegrate any material; rock, steel, cement, using a fast and controllable impact - electric arc rotating 800 times per second. This also gives us the ability to generate shock waves for drilling and reservoir stimulation.

We have successfully integrated proven technologies with our new inventions which are protected by 12 patents.

With the existing 12.5 metre quay being extended by 75-metres to 130 metres, it will have a load-bearing capacity of 60 tonnes per square metre, unique in Scotland. The versatile quay, capable of taking an offshore structure in a single lift, will also support subsea development projects.

Around 40,000 square metres of adjacent laydown will be completed this year, bringing the port’s total dedicated laydown areas to 130,000 square metres.

Captain Calum Grains, Lerwick Port Authority Harbour Master and Deputy Chief Executive, said: “Lerwick, with its considerable experience and range of facilities, is ready-made for decommissioning – a status which will be enhanced by the Dales Voe project, making it uniquely-placed to handle decommissioning in Scotland.”

Lerwick is an established and active decommissioning centre making the most of its natural advantages – positioned at 60 degrees north, proximity to fields east and west, sheltered, deep water to 50 metres and 24-hour access – combined with tried-and-tested facilities and services, including Greenhead Base, and a track-record in decommissioning and wider support for the offshore industry.

The port’s extensive resources have the capacity to accommodate the biggest heavy-lift vessels and flexibility to handle both large heavy lift and piece small decommissioning operations, including the only licensed quayside decommissioning pad in Scotland
